Speech-Language Pathologist Salary in Jacksonville, FL: $103,813 (2026)
Quick Answer:A full-time speech-language pathologist in Jacksonville, FL earns a median $103,813/year (≈ $49.92/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 29-1127). Once you factor in Jacksonville's price level (1% below national, BEA RPP 99.5), that paycheck buys what $104,351 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 0.7% above the Florida state average.

Salary Trajectory for Speech-Language Pathologists in Jacksonville (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 3.99%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$78,700 | Actual |
| 2020 | $81,340 | Actual |
| 2021 | $77,660 | Actual |
| 2022 | $85,970 | Actual |
| 2023 | $92,920 | Actual |
| 2024 | $94,920 | Actual |
| 2025 | $99,830 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$103,813 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$107,955 |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Jacksonville metropolitan area, the median speech-language pathologist salary grew 26.8% from $78,700 (2019) to $99,830 (2025). At a 3.99%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$107,955 by 2027 — a total increase of $29,255 (37.17%) from 2019.

Speech-Language Pathologist Job Market in Jacksonville
Currently, approximately 650 speech-language pathologists are employed in Jacksonville, contributing to a solid local job market. Salaries can vary widely depending on the work setting, with hospitals and skilled nursing facilities often paying more than schools or private practices. The local cost-of-living index of 99.484, which is below the national average, means that take-home pay can stretch further for SLPs here compared to other regions. Employers such as hospital inpatient rehabilitation centers tend to offer more competitive salaries, while school districts remain the largest source of employment for speech-language pathologists in Jacksonville. Factors affecting salary variation include the type of contract (year-round versus school year), specialty certifications, and demand for bilingual SLPs.
